我有一个在.net MVC中开发并使用“SourceSansPro”字体的应用程序。
将导入的google字体导入css为。这是css文件的第一个声明
@import url(//fonts.googleapis.com/css?family=Source+Sans+Pro:300,400,600,700,300italic,400italic,600italic);
当我在本地运行时,字体正确加载但在Azure上发布后,看起来它们没有加载。
在检查Azure应用程序上的字体后,字体正在应用但是大小比它在本地看起来的大,但是所有应用的css类和属性都是相同的。
尝试了什么 -
尝试将字体嵌入到解决方案目录中,删除了cdn并使用了嵌入字体。对Web配置中的MIME类型进行必要的更改,如下所示
尝试禁用捆绑
你能指导一下,我做错了什么地方? 我们想使用cdn本身而不是嵌入字体